Understanding the Psychology Behind Betting Behavior
Betting behavior is deeply rooted in psychological principles that affect decision-making. Many bettors often fall prey to cognitive biases that skew their judgment, leading to poor choices. For instance, the illusion of control can make individuals believe they have more influence over the outcomes than they actually do. Similarly, confirmation bias can skew perceptions, prompting bettors to seek out only information that supports their pre-existing beliefs. By recognizing these psychological traps, bettors can enhance their awareness and make more rational decisions.
Understanding the emotional triggers that propel betting behavior is equally vital. High stakes can evoke feelings of excitement, thrill, and sometimes fear, which may cloud logical reasoning. To navigate this psychological landscape, bettors can adopt strategies such as:
- Setting Limits: Establish clear boundaries for time and money spent on betting.
- Practicing Mindfulness: Stay present and aware of emotions while placing bets to avoid impulsive decisions.
- Conducting Research: Make informed decisions by relying on data rather than gut feelings.
By following these tips, individuals can effectively manage their betting habits and mitigate the psychological factors leading to potential traps.
Identifying Common Betting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them
When diving into the world of betting, it’s crucial to remain aware of common pitfalls that can derail even the most seasoned gamblers. One major trap is the tendency to let emotions dictate betting decisions. This can lead to impulsive choices, often resulting in losses. Staying calm and rational is essential. Consider adopting the following strategies to maintain sound judgment:
- Set a Budget: Allocate a fixed amount for betting each month, ensuring you never exceed this limit.
- Take Breaks: Regularly step back to clear your mind; it helps in reassessing your strategies and reducing emotional decision-making.
- Stay Informed: Knowledge about teams, players, and trends can provide a more rational basis for your bets.
Another common oversight is chasing losses, where people attempt to win back what they’ve lost by placing even riskier bets. This strategy can spiral out of control and lead to more significant financial troubles. Instead, practice professional discipline by adhering to a betting plan. Consider these guidelines for effective loss management:
Strategy | Description |
---|---|
Limit Losses | Know when to stop; set limits to avoid further losses. |
Assess Bets | Review each bet’s potential return on investment carefully. |
Learn from Mistakes | Keep a betting journal to reflect on past bets and adjust your strategy accordingly. |
Creating a Solid Bankroll Management Strategy
To maintain a healthy and sustainable gambling experience, it’s essential to establish a well-defined management strategy for your bankroll. This strategy helps you avoid overspending and ensures your betting activities remain enjoyable without negatively impacting your financial situation. Start by determining your total bankroll, which should be an amount you can afford to lose without compromising your daily expenses. Divide your bankroll into smaller units or stakes, allowing you to spread your bets across multiple events. This approach minimizes the risk of significant losses and provides a systematic way to track profits and losses.
Adopting a disciplined mindset is vital for effective bankroll management. Consider implementing the following practices:
- Set Betting Limits: Establish clear upper limits for both daily and weekly betting sessions.
- Adjust Based on Performance: Regularly evaluate your betting outcomes and adjust your unit sizes accordingly.
- Separate Funds: Keep your betting bankroll separate from other financial resources to maintain clarity and control.
By prioritizing a structured approach to your finances, you can enhance your enjoyment and longevity in sports betting, steering clear of pitfalls while maximizing your chances for success.
Leveraging Research and Data for Informed Betting Decisions
In the realm of betting, the savvy punter understands that knowledge is power. By utilizing comprehensive data analysis and thorough research, you can significantly improve your chances of making informed bets. Consider the following strategies:
- Historical Performance: Dive into past performances of teams or players to gauge trends and patterns.
- Statistics: Use advanced statistics to assess factors like home/away performance and head-to-head matchups.
- Injury Reports: Stay updated on player injuries that could impact game results.
- Weather Conditions: Be aware of how weather might affect outdoor sports events.
Another critical element in strategic betting is understanding the odds and market movements. This involves not only knowing how to read the odds but also recognizing how they can shift based on betting volume and market sentiments. Employ the following techniques:
- Odds Comparison: Compare odds from multiple sportsbooks to ensure you’re getting the best value.
- Market Analysis: Observe betting patterns – sudden shifts in the odds can indicate insider knowledge or public opinion swaying.
- Value Betting: Look for opportunities where the odds do not accurately reflect the probable outcomes.
